/*
Title: PhotoSCET nbc.com
Author: Thomas Wu
version: 4NOV2008
colorcodes:
#000
#eee
#202020
#393939
/assets/images/scet20/photo/sites/96/

*/
@import url('/who-do-you-think-you-are/css/common.css');

body#nbc_photoSCET {
	color:#ceffff;
}

body #jf_mast_header{
	background-position:37px 0;
}
body #scet_mainContent a:link, body #scet_mainContent a:visited{
	text-decoration:none;
}
body #scet_mainContent a:hover, body #scet_mainContent a:active {
	text-decoration:none;
}
#scet_mainContent{
	float:left;
	z-index:0;
	/*height:543px;*/
}
#scet_vidPlayer_col{
	width:640px;
}
#scet_header{
	font-size:120%;
	color:#FCE235;
}
#designEl_1{
	/*background:transparent url('/assets/images/scet20/photo/sites/96/ps_office_header.jpg') scroll no-repeat 0 0;*/
	/*background:#000000 none repeat scroll 0 0;*/
	width:645px;
	height:71px;
	position:absolute;
	top:-30px;
	left:1px;
	z-index:0;
}
#scet_vidPlayer_ad{
	z-index:100;
	position:relative;
	/*this div can be defined to accomdate any background image */
}
body #contain_browse_all ul li a{
	color:#eee;
}
body #contain_browse_all ul li a:hover{
	color:#666;
}
.mod300_inner h4{
	color:#ccc;
	font-weight:bold;
	text-transform:uppercase;
	letter-spacing:-1px;
	margin-top:3px;
}
.mod300_inner ul.mod300_list {
}
#promo_col{
	float:left;
	margin-left:0;
}
#promo_col .scet_mod300{
/*adjust background color and BG*/
background-color:#fff;
}
.mod300_inner{}

.scet_mod300 ul#mod300Nav{
background-color:#000;
background-image:url('/who-do-you-think-you-are/images/scet/scet-tabs.gif');
}
.scet_mod300 ul#mod300Nav .toggleTABVid {
	background-position:0 -188px;
}
.mod300_inner ul.mod300_list li{
	color:#eee;
	background-color:#202020;
}

.mod300_inner ul.mod300_list li.alt{
	background-color:#202020;
}
.mod300_inner ul.mod300_list li a{
	color:#000;
}
.mod300_inner ul.mod300_list li:hover{
opacity: 0.5;
-moz-opacity: 0.5;
filter:alpha(opacity=50);
}
/*Main Image Viewer*/
#title_goBack{
	/*change the tabs out*/
	color:#111;
	background: transparent url('/who-do-you-think-you-are/images/scet/scet-tabs.gif') no-repeat 0 -218px;
}
#title_goBack h2{
	color:#eee;
	font-weight:bold;
}

#scet_main_videoPlayer{
	background-color:#393939;
}

#scet_aboutShareTags{
	/*fallon*/
	margin-left:0;
}

#scet_aboutShareTags ul#aboutShareTags_tabs{
	background-image:url('/who-do-you-think-you-are/images/scet/scet-tabs.gif');
}
.scet_con{
	color:#eee;
	background-color:#393939;
}


#scet_comments_wrap{
color:#000;	
/*fallon*/
margin-left:0;
}
ul#scet_comments_nav{
	/*adjust background*/
	background-image:url('/who-do-you-think-you-are/images/scet/scet-tabs.gif');
}

/*==Comments==*/
#scet_usrComments_holder, #scet_postComments_holder{
	background:#393939;
	color:#eee;
}
.sn_comment_div{

}
.sn_comment_form_div{
	color:#eee;
}
#scet_contacts_login{
	
}
/*Buttons*/
#share_code{}

a#btn_copytoclip{
	background:transparent url('/assets/images/scet20/photo/sites/96/btn_psSCET.gif') scroll no-repeat -24px -63px;	
}

.scet_contact_list_container p input#scet_contacts_submit_btn{
	background:transparent url('/assets/images/scet20/photo/sites/96/btn_psSCET.gif') scroll no-repeat -24px -46px;	
}
#share_content form#send2friend input#inputBTN_send{
	background-image:url('/assets/images/scet20/photo/sites/96/special_SCET_buttons.gif');
}

/* Other Elements */
#ad-space{
	background:none;
}

/*=stars rating redo ==*/
.star-rating, .star-rating a:hover, .star-rating a:active, .star-rating a:focus, .star-rating .current-rating {
	background-image: url('/assets/images/scet20/photo/sites/96/star.gif');
}
/*=Pager==*/

/*==Pager==*/
#scet_browse_pager{
	padding:0;
}
.nbcu_pager{
margin-top:5px;
}
.nbcu_pager a span{
	width:19px;
}
.nbcu_pager a:link, .nbcu_pager a:visited{
	text-decoration:none;
}
.nbcu_pager a:hover, .nbcu_pager a:active{
	background:#ff2d00;
	color:#000;
}
body a.nbcu_pager_active{
	background:#ff2d00;
	color:#000;
}
a.nbcu_pager_page{
	background-color:#eee;
	color:#eee;
}
a:link.nbcu_pager_last, a:link.nbcu_pager_first, a:link.nbcu_pager_previous, a:link.nbcu_pager_next{
	margin:0 4px;padding:0 0;
	border:none;
}
a:visited.nbcu_pager_last, a:visited.nbcu_pager_first, a:visited.nbcu_pager_previous, a:visited.nbcu_pager_next{
	border:none;
}

/*==mynbc elements==*/
#scet_group_contact_container{}
#myNBC_contact_list{}
.scet_contact_list_container{}
.scet_contact_list{}
.scet_contact_list_thanks{}

/*
Browse Section:
color codes:
#202020
#393939
#333
#666
#111
#ccc
tabIMG: /who-do-you-think-you-are/images/scet/scet-tabs.gif
*/


#scet_video_lib{
	position:relative;
	background:#393939;
	color:#fff;
	padding-top:15px;
	/*fallon*/
	margin-left:5px;
}
#scet_video_lib ul{
	text-transform:none;
	list-style-type:none;
	margin:5px 0px 14px;
	padding:0;
}
#scet_video_lib ul li{
	font-size:11px;
	color:#ccc;
	margin:1px 0;
}
/*=cust*/
#scet_video_lib ul li a:link, #scet_video_lib ul li a:visited{
	color:#fff;
}
#scet_video_lib ul li a:hover{
	color:#000;
	text-decoration:none;
}
#scet_video_lib ul li.onSelect, #scet_video_lib ul li.onSelect a, #video_lib ul li.onSelect a:link{
	background:#ccc;
	color:#333;
	font-weight:bold;
}
#scet_video_lib a:link, #scet_video_lib a:visited{
color:#333;
}
 #scet_video_lib li.onSelect a{
	background:#999;
	color:#333;
}
#scet_video_lib a:hover{
	background:#ccc;
color:#000;
}
/*=cust*/
#scet_video_lib h2{
	background:transparent url('/who-do-you-think-you-are/images/scet/scet-tabs.gif') scroll no-repeat -480px -259px;
	color:#eee;
}
/*=cust*/
#scet_video_lib h4{
	text-transform: uppercase;
	font-size:11px;
	border-top:1px solid #111;
	border-bottom:1px solid #333;
	font-family: Arial, "MS Trebuchet", sans-serif;	
	padding:2px 5px;
	margin:20px 0 0;
	background:#202020;
	color:#ccc;
}
#browse_container{
background:#393939;
}
/*=cust*/
#browse_container h2{
	position:absolute;
	top:-5px;
	left:0;
z-index:1000;
color:#eee;
	background:transparent url('/who-do-you-think-you-are/images/scet/scet-tabs.gif') scroll no-repeat 0 -259px;
}
#browse_container h2 span#about_GalleryName{
color:#eee;
}
#orgby{	
	display:block;
	position:relative;
	float:left;
	clear:both;
	width:100%;
	height:auto;
	margin:10px 0 0;
	padding:0;
}
#orgby span{
	display:block;
	float:right;
	width:90px;
	margin:6px 0 0 0;
	opacity: 0.5;
	-moz-opacity: 0.5;
	filter:alpha(opacity=50);
}
#orgby ul{
	float:right;
	list-style-type:none;
	margin:0 2px 0 0;
	padding:0;
	height:23px;
}
#orgby ul li{
	list-style-type: none;
	float:left;		
	margin:0;
	padding:0;
}
#orgby ul li a:link, #orgby ul li a:visited{
	float:left;
	color:#999;
	padding:3px 6px 3px;
	height:15px;
	margin: 0 2px 0;
	border:1px #999 solid;
	text-transform: uppercase;
	text-decoration: none;
	font-size:11px;
	font-family: Arial, "MS Trebuchet", sans-serif;
}
#orgby ul li.selectORG a:link, #orgby ul li.selectORG a:visited{
	border-color: #999;
	padding-bottom:5px;
	border-bottom:none;
	background:#393939;
	color:#fff;
}
#orgby ul li a:hover{
	color:#fff;
}
#browse_results{
	background:#202020;
	border: 1px solid #666;
	color:#eee;
}
#promo_col .scet_mod300 {
	position:relative;
background:#393939;
}
.scet_mod300 h3{
	position:absolute;
	width:296px;
	height:27px;
	top:-1px;
	left:0;
	margin:0;
	padding:3px 0 0 5px;
	color:#eee;
	background:transparent url('/who-do-you-think-you-are/images/scet/scet-tabs.gif') scroll no-repeat 0 -294px;
}



ul.scet_th_list{
	float:left;
	list-style-type: none;
	margin:10px 8px 12px;padding:0 0 5px;
	_margin-left:5px;
	width:450px;
		height:auto;
		min-height:100px;
	border-bottom: 1px solid #333;
}
ul.scet_th_list li{
	list-style-type: none;
	float:left;
	width:83px;
	height:auto;line-height:11px;
	margin-right:39px;
	padding:0;
	overflow:hidden;
	font-size:10px;
	white-space: normal;
}
ul.scet_th_list li.list_full_detail{
	position:relative;
	clear:both;
	width:449px;background:#333;
	margin:0;
	margin-top:3px;
	margin-bottom:2px;
	padding:5px 0 9px;
	font-size:11px;
}
a.list_full_det_thumb{
	float:left;
}
ul.scet_th_list li.list_full_detail img{
	float:left;
}
ul.scet_th_list li.list_full_detail p{
	float:left;
	margin-left:6px;
	margin-bottom:2px;
	font-size:11px;
	text-align:left;
	width:210px;
}
ul.scet_th_list li.list_full_detail p em{
	padding-right:10px;
}
li.list_full_detail .list_full_det_time{
	position:absolute;
	top:2px;
	right:3px;
	width:140px;
}
ul.scet_th_list li.list_full_detail .list_full_det_time p{
	float:right;
	clear:both;
		width:135px;
	color:#999;
	margin:0 0 2px;padding:0;
}
li.list_full_detail .list_fullep_linkTo{
	position:absolute;
	bottom:0px;
	right:0px;
	padding:3px;
	/*border:1px #2F2C2C solid;*/
}
.list_fullep_linkTo a:link, .list_fullep_linkTo a:visited{
	color:#fff;
	text-decoration:underline;
	margin:0 4px;
}
ul.scet_th_list li.list_full_detail .sct_playIC{

}
ul.scet_th_list li.list_full_detail p.list_full_des{
	float:left;
	width:218px;
}
ul.scet_th_list li.scet_th_list_last{
	margin-right:0;
}
ul.scet_th_list li p .scet_th_normal{
	clear:both;
}
ul.scet_th_list li img{
	float:left;
	border: 1px solid #9B9B9B;
}

/*********************************
	photo scet speicific thumbs
	#nbc_photoSCET
**********************************/
#nbc_photoSCET ul.scet_th_list li{
	margin-right:15px;
	width:97px; 
}
#nbc_photoSCET ul.scet_th_list li p{
	float:left;
	margin:0;
	padding:0;
	width:82px;
	margin-right:-2px;
}
#nbc_photoSCET ul.scet_th_list.scet_th_full{
	margin-bottom:none;
	margin-top:none;
	border:none;
	padding:0;
	margin:0 8px;
}

#formSearchVid{
	margin:5px 5px 12px;
}
#formSearchVid input{
	border: 1px solid #eee;
	background:#999;
	width:105px;
	font-size:12px;
}

a.sct_playIC{
	width:46px;
	height:10px;
	display:none;
	float:right;
	margin:0;
	padding:0;
	background:transparent url(/assets/images/scet20/scet_playIC.gif) scroll no-repeat 0 0;
	text-decoration:none;
	text-indent:-9999px;
	overflow:hidden;
}
a.sct_dl_IC{
	display:block;
	float:right;
	width:73px;
	height:10px;
	background: #DDD url(/assets/images/scet20/scet_dl_ic.gif) no-repeat scroll 0 0;
	text-indent:-9999px;
	overflow:hidden;
	padding:0;
	margin:2px 0 3px;
}

#promo_col{
	float:left;
	margin:0 0 0 22px;
	_margin-left:20px;
	background:transparent;
	width:302px;
	min-height:500px;
}
.mod300_inner{
color:#eee;
background:#393939;
display:block;padding-top:30px;
}
.mod300_inner ul.mod300_list {
background:#393939;
}
.mod300_inner ul.mod300_list li{
	color:#eee;
	border-bottom: 1px solid #333;
	background:#393939;
}
ul.mod300_list li p{
	_margin-right:-3px;
}
ul.mod300_list li img, a img.mod300_list_img{
	position:absolute;
	left:4px;
	top:4px;
	border:none;
	display:block;
	text-indent:none;
}
body ul.mod300_list li a:link{
	color:#eee;
	text-decoration:none;
}
table.sn_login_form_TABLE td #sn_remember{
	float:left;
}
#scet_browse_pager{

}
.nbcu_pager a{
	color:#aaa;
}
a.nbcu_pager_page{
	background:#1B1B1B;
	color:#eee;
}

body a.nbcu_pager_active{
	background-color:#ff2d00;
	color:#000;
}

.tagged_words, .tagged_words a {
	color:#fff!important;
}


#nbc_photoSCET #sn_login_submit_btn {
	float:left;
width:110px;
	height:25px;
margin:0!important;
padding:0!important;
}

#nbc_photoSCET #facebook_or{
float:left;
margin:0 3px 0 3px!important;
padding:0 3px 0 0!important;
}

#nbc_photoSCET #fb_logon_btn_horiz {
float:left;
margin:0 0px 0 5px!important;
padding:0 0 0 5px!important;
}


/*==self clearing floats*/
#browse_container:after,
ul.mod300_list li:after,#scet_browse_pager:after{
	content: "."; 
	display: block; 
    height: 0;
    clear: both; 
    visibility: hidden;
}

/* PSCET NAV */

#pscet_nav {
	float:left;
	width: 971px;
	height: 91px;
	background: transparent url(/assets/images/scet20/photo/sites/96/pscet_chuck_nav_bg.jpg) top left repeat-x;
}

.mod300_inner #photo_promotes ul.mod300_list li {
	height:92px;
}

#photo_promotes ul.mod300_list li p {
	margin-left:50px;
}

#photo_promotes ul.mod300_list img {
	height:90px;
	width:120px;
}

* html #photo_promotes ul.mod300_list li p {
	margin-left:25px;
	width: 130px;
}

#pscet_nav #flash_nav_container {
	width: 839px;
	height: 80px;
	float: right;
}

#browse_container h2 {
	height: 32px;
}
